Pieter van Laer: Bridging Dutch Realism and Italian Sensibility

Pieter van Laer (c. 1599 – 1642) stands as a pivotal figure in the burgeoning Baroque landscape of the Netherlands, yet his artistic legacy extends far beyond national borders thanks to his pioneering role in establishing the Bamboccianti style—a movement that profoundly impacted Italian art and captivated audiences with its depiction of everyday life. Born in Haarlem, Van Laer’s formative years coincided with a period of intense artistic experimentation, fueled by the humanist ideals circulating throughout Europe and mirroring the dynamism of the era. While biographical details remain somewhat elusive – records indicate he married Anna Maria van Berckenhorst in 1628 – his prolific output speaks volumes about his dedication to capturing the complexities of human experience.
  • Early Influences: Van Laer’s artistic journey began under the tutelage of Frans Hals, a master of portraiture whose meticulous realism and psychological insight undoubtedly shaped his approach to painting.
  • The Bamboccianti Style: Recognizing the limitations of traditional academic art, Van Laer championed a revolutionary style—the Bamboccianti—characterized by its vibrant color palettes, dynamic compositions, and unflinching portrayal of rustic scenes populated by peasants engaged in lively activities. This stylistic innovation drew inspiration from Italian artists like Caravaggio and Guido Reni, who similarly prioritized dramatic realism over idealized beauty.
His artistic output spanned a remarkable breadth of subjects, ranging from grand landscapes imbued with atmospheric perspective to intimate genre paintings depicting domestic life—scenes brimming with detail and emotion. Notably, “Departure from the Inn” exemplifies his masterful command of light and shadow, skillfully conveying the palpable tension between departure and anticipation. Similarly, "The Herdsmen" showcases Van Laer’s ability to imbue ordinary subjects with profound psychological depth. These paintings aren't merely representations; they are windows into the human condition, reflecting the anxieties and joys inherent in daily existence.
  • Notable Works: Among his most celebrated pieces is “Bentvueghels in a Roman Tavern,” a captivating tableau capturing a gathering of Dutch artists documenting their experiences in Rome during the Baroque period. This artwork brilliantly illustrates Van Laer’s fascination with both artistic innovation and cultural exchange.
  • Legacy & Significance: Pieter van Laer's contribution to art history is undeniable. He solidified the Bamboccianti style as a cornerstone of Italian Baroque painting, influencing generations of artists and establishing a new aesthetic standard—one that prioritized realism alongside expressive dynamism. His paintings continue to resonate with viewers today, reminding us of the enduring power of art to illuminate human experience.
His influence extended beyond stylistic considerations; Van Laer’s meticulous observation of nature and his nuanced understanding of human psychology cemented his position as a visionary artist who captured the spirit of his time. Pieter van Laer's legacy endures not merely as an artist, but as a catalyst for artistic transformation—a testament to his unwavering commitment to portraying life with honesty and beauty.
